Black Friday is one of the most beloved traditions in the country, offering people the chance to obtain unbeatable deals on a wide range of items. Because of the enthusiasm shoppers display during Black Friday, however, injuries occur all too often. Learn more about the most common injuries you could experience.
1. Broken Bones
In 2024, there were 126 million in-store shoppers in the country during the Black Friday holiday weekend. That translates to huge crowds of people. All of the resulting jostling can lead to slip and fall accidents that could put you at risk of being injured. This type of frenzy can quickly result in broken bones.
Aside from in-store accidents, you can have issues while getting to and from your favorite store. Car accidents tend to increase during the Black Friday weekend. Auto insurers note that claims spike every year at this time, with speeding, distracted driving, and aggressive driving being the most common issues. You can sustain broken bones even from relatively minor crashes.
2. Facial Injuries
Falling and getting trampled in the chaos of Black Friday shopping can result in issues such as cracked teeth, broken noses, and cuts from shoes and other items. Facial injuries can impact you for the rest of your life, especially if they require cosmetic surgery. The same can occur if you’re in a crash and you hit your face on your vehicle’s structure.
3. Head Trauma
Your skull and brain can also suffer during this shopping event. People tend to shove one another to reach the best deals, potentially causing you to hit yourself against shelves and other people.
The number of items being shifted about can also mean that shelves could fall or heavy products could topple onto you, hitting you hard enough to cause a concussion or other types of injuries.
You can also be kicked if you fall or might be hit by shopping carts. Any time that enough force causes your brain to shift or twist, you can suffer temporary changes in the way your brain works.
4. Soft Tissue Injuries
The potential for violent energy you encounter when shopping during Black Friday could result in sustaining bruises, cuts, and even whiplash. Soft tissue injuries are typically not immediately apparent. You might not notice that you were hurt for a few hours or even days. When swelling begins, pain usually follows.
5. Back Injuries
Enthusiastic shoppers often try to lift hefty items without relying on more than their adrenaline to do so. That can lead to herniated discs and damaged nerves. Your vertebrae could slip out of place, too, leaving you with the inability to move normally and causing severe pain.
If you fall or if you’re in a car accident during Black Friday, back injuries could be even more severe. You can break vertebrae or damage spinal cord nerves enough to result in loss of motor function or sensation below the injury.
